Royal Mint Honors Freddie Mercury with New Commemorative Coin
Source: QUEEN – The Royal Mint Unveils New FREDDIE MERCURY Coin; Contest Launched To Win One 2025 UK 1oz Silver Proof Colour Coin (2025-11-19)
The Royal Mint has officially unveiled a stunning new 1oz silver proof colour coin honoring the legendary Freddie Mercury, marking a significant milestone in British numismatic history. This release celebrates the 40th anniversary of Queen’s iconic Live Aid performance and Mercury’s debut solo album, blending musical legacy with numismatic artistry. The coin is part of the prestigious Music Legends collection and is available in multiple editions, including limited signed versions and vibrant colour-printed variants, appealing to both collectors and fans worldwide.
